$36 (cart included), played on Saturday, June 2008 at noon
The starter was a jerk from the moment I arrived. The snack bar closed before we got done with 9 holes, we teed off at 1:30 pm. The fairways looked and played like they hadn't seen water in weeks. The greens were in good shape. Because of the staff, and condition of the course, I will not be playing it again. What was funny, is that they have a dress code, for what? I've seen better public city courses.
Would travel: 0-10 Miles, Not Vacation Worthy
Bottom line: Worse than average course for the area
